advice on remap

hi there, im new to the site so please bare with me, i am considering remapping my gp 1.9 mjet sporting and was wondering if i would need a new clutch? or if that would depend on how powerfull i have the remap

Hi & Welcome here!

Just treat the car with care and empathy, remember you will be exceeding all the transmission design elements, no need to upgrade unless you are going to be doing hard Track days or utilising all the re-map energy it can muster.

I was remapped (see Sig below) at 32,000 miles, 62,000 miles now all been fine.
